So, what you would want to use instead are long-tailed keywords. Long-tailed keywords are longer, more specific search phrases with lower search volumes. These keywords are not attractive enough to be used by big brands, it's just too much effort for too little gain. But, for a small affiliate website, long-tailed keywords are a perfect opportunity to start ranking in search.

Some companies choose to pay a percentage for every sale; others have a flat-rate amount that is paid for each conversion. Others pay-by-view and hope that they will achieve enough conversions for this to be monetarily feasible. There are also companies that choose to pay continuously on a lead-generation basis.
As an affiliate, you’re paid for performance. Following are the three types of performance-based models common to affiliate marketing: Pay–Per–Click (PPC) – An affiliate gets paid for all the valid clicks generated regardless of whether these clicks resulted in sales or leads.Pay–Per–Lead (PPL) – Companies pay a fixed commission for every qualified action a click generated. This action might include things like installation of an app, online form submission, free trial sign-up, or completion of a short survey.Pay–Per–Sale (PPS) – Companies pay a percentage of all qualified sales. This percentage is agreed upon by the company and its affiliate. Among the most common PPS programs is Amazon Associates, where a publisher can earn up to 15% depending on the products sold.
